The first CO2 heat pump for the Swedish market was released by Ahlsell on July 10th, 2005
Capacity-controlled by a variable-speed control (inverter).
An air source heat pump provides both space heating and domestic hot water (DHW) heating.
It is claimed to deliver 4.5 kW heat power down to an outdoor air tempe-rature of -15 °C and to be able to heat the water up to +70 °C.
